©
本文档使用 PHP中文网手册 发布
(PECL memcached >= 0.1.0)
Memcached::add — 向一个新的key下面增加一个元素
$key
, mixed $value
[, int $expiration
] ) Memcached::add() 与 Memcached::set() 类似,但是如果
key
已经在服务端存在,此操作会失败。
key
用于存储值的键名。
value
存储的值。
expiration
到期时间,默认为 0。 更多信息请参见到期时间。
成功时返回 TRUE
, 或者在失败时返回 FALSE
。
如果key已经存在, Memcached::getResultCode() 方法将会返回 Memcached::RES_NOTSTORED
。
[#1] zhoujunwen888 at 126 dot com [2015-06-17 09:27:10]
<?php
$mem = new Memcached();
$mem->addServer('127.0.0.1',11211);
if( $mem->add("mystr","this is a memcache test!",3600)){
echo '???????????!';
}else{
echo '??????????'.$mem->get("mystr");
}
?>